CVE:CVE-2019-25695 vulnerable 2026-06-08 05:13:42.787195 R 3.4.4 Local Buffer Overflow Windows XP SP3
HIGH (8.4)
R 3.4.4 contains a local buffer overflow vulnerability that allows attackers to execute arbitrary code by injecting malicious input into the GUI Preferences language field. Attackers can craft a payload with a 292-byte offset and JMP ESP instruction to execute commands like calc.exe when the payload is pasted into the Language for menus and messages field.

CVE:CVE-2019-25485 vulnerable 2026-06-08 05:13:42.434276 R 3.4.4 Windows x64 Buffer Overflow SEH DEP ASLR Bypass
MEDIUM (6.2)
R 3.4.4 on Windows x64 contains a buffer overflow vulnerability in the GUI Preferences language menu field that allows local attackers to bypass DEP and ASLR protections. Attackers can inject a crafted payload through the Language for menus preference to trigger a structured exception handler chain pivot and execute arbitrary shellcode with application privileges.
